**Ticket PNTS-state: Config drift on loyalty-points ledger**

The PointGrove ledger nodes in the Marblewick cluster have drifted from the committed baseline. Two replicas accrue points with the old rounding rule, producing reconciliation deltas of up to 12 points per member per week. Please do not hand-patch nodes again; redeploy from the baseline and verify checksums afterward. For future maintainers tracing this incident, the authoritative values the ledger must converge on are recorded below.

config for kawif-hahig:
zorix:
  log_level: error
  metrics_host: metrics.zorix.lumiclabs.internal
  pool_size: 16

## Restock planner — plugin notes

If you're writing a plugin for SnackRoute's restock planner, know this: the planner batches machine telemetry every few minutes, so don't expect instant inventory updates. Your plugin gets called after route optimization, not before. Keep handlers fast or Kettleworth's scheduler will time you out. When testing locally, spin up the sandbox with the same settings we run in staging, listed here.

service settings:
PRAIX_LOG_LEVEL=error
PRAIX_METRICS_HOST=metrics.praix.qorvelcorp.corp
PRAIX_POOL_SIZE=16

Management Meeting Minutes — Franchise Agreement

The committee reviewed the draft franchise agreement between Saffron Hearth Kitchens and the Vellmore operating group. Terms discussed: a seven-year term, standardised fit-out requirements, and a tiered royalty schedule. Concerns about territory overlap near Ashgate were referred to the expansion team. Legal will circulate a revised draft within two weeks. Heads of department should consult the confidential note on business plans set out below.

board note of baguf-fafog: Kasixox Foods plans to lower the Drueth list price by 48 percent in March.